Cross-continental team communication presents unique challenges. When a Sydney-based team and their Manila counterparts began experiencing significant friction, impacting project delivery and overall morale, it was clear that proactive intervention was needed. The goal? To foster seamless collaboration and build a stronger, more unified team.

Uncovering the Pain Points

Understanding the root cause of the communication breakdown required a comprehensive approach. We began by gathering input from stakeholders through a multi-faceted process. Online surveys provided anonymised quantitative data, while individual interviews and focus groups offered qualitative insights. Common themes emerged: time zone differences leading to delayed responses, cultural nuances causing misunderstandings, and inconsistent technology usage creating frustration. For instance, a common complaint was, “By the time we receive a response from Manila, our Sydney workday is over, leading to project delays.” Cultural differences were also highlighted, with some Sydney team members reporting feeling their direct communication style was misinterpreted as aggressive by their Manila colleagues.

Pinpointing the Root Causes

Analysis of the collected data revealed three primary areas requiring attention: time zone management, cultural sensitivity, and technology optimisation. The time zone disparity necessitated structured communication windows. Cultural differences required awareness and training to promote mutual understanding. Finally, inconsistent technology usage highlighted the need for standardised tools and training.

Fostering Connection

To address these issues, we designed a hybrid team-building event, blending in-person and virtual elements. The event was structured to:

  • Build Relationships: Icebreakers and collaborative activities were designed to foster personal connections, regardless of location.
  • Enhance Cultural Awareness: Interactive sessions explored cultural differences and promoted respectful communication strategies.
  • Improve Communication Skills: Role-playing exercises and scenario-based discussions focused on clear and concise communication.
  • Optimise Technology Usage: In-depth discussions revealed best practices for using shared communication platforms.

We utilised video conferencing to ensure seamless participation from both locations, incorporating breakout rooms for smaller group discussions and Miro as a collaborative online workspace for brainstorming.

Breaking Down Barriers

The event was facilitated with a focus on inclusivity and engagement. The positive impact was immediately apparent. Participants reported feeling more connected and understood. For example, the cultural awareness session facilitated open discussions, leading to a deeper appreciation of each team’s perspective. “I now understand why certain phrases were misinterpreted,” one participant noted. The technology discussion also led to increased confidence and efficiency in using shared platforms.

Maintaining Momentum

To ensure sustained improvement, we implemented regular touchpoints. These included:

  • Weekly Synchronisation Meetings: Scheduled during overlapping working hours to facilitate real-time communication.
  • Shared Communication Channels: Dedicated online channels for project updates and informal communication.
  • Rotating "Communication Champions": Team members taking turns to ensure best practices are followed.
  • Celebrating the Wins: Team members in both locations agreed to setup a Friday afternoon "Connect and Celebrate" event, to highlight the achievements that week.
Measuring and Adapting

The team are tracking progress through regular surveys and feedback sessions, measuring communication effectiveness and identifying areas for improvement. Encouraging a culture of continuous improvement is paramount. Through our discussions, they now actively solicit feedback and adapt our strategies based on evolving needs.
